io_glue_destroy() now uses an extra callback to handle type specific
[imager.git] / Imager.xs
index 531dd626035369fd3618ab6d49e57747934e5cb5..c0c5e940f5b7d8fba8bf09d9533802c7eae89c14 100644 (file)
--- a/Imager.xs
+++ b/Imager.xs
@@ -879,6 +879,9 @@ i_int_hlines_dump(i_int_hlines *hlines) {
 #define i_exif_enabled() 0
 #endif
 
+/* trying to use more C style names, map them here */
+#define io_glue_DESTROY(ig) io_glue_destroy(ig)
+
 MODULE = Imager                PACKAGE = Imager::Color PREFIX = ICL_
 
 Imager::Color